Job description
Duties: Responsible for the day-to-day operations of an application portfolio (e.g. application maintenance, stability, innovation, development, incident, change & problem management) inclusive of a vendor team of resources within an outcome-based contract. Responsible for service delivery oversight which includes Technical Risk Management, Incident, Problem & Change Management oversight performance management, Process Management and Vendor Management. Seek to achieve the highest value service from vendors and evaluates vendor performance based on vendor metrics. Ensure proper coordination of software application design, development, testing, quality assurance, configuration, installation and support to ensure smooth, stable and timely implementation of work requests and issue resolution. Provide technical and application portfolio risk management consulting leadership to managers and the supplier. Accountable for the technical delivery of work by the supplier for a defined portfolio. Ensure delivery and planning of large application maintenance and currency efforts in partnership with the supplier and project management. Coordinate with the supplier and the Application Development Project team to transition services and support the application maintenance transition activities. Telecommuting permitted.
Requirements
Requirements: Requires a Bachelor's degree or foreign equivalent in Computer Science, Computer Applications, or a related field, and five (5) years of experience as a Software Engineer, Software
Developer or a related position.
Experience must include: Working with Windows and UNIX operating systems; Working with Java/ J2EE and UNIX programming languages; Utilizing Spring Boot, webMethods 10.x,9.x,8.x, SQL Developer, Oracle 9i, Oracle 10g, webMethods Flow Language, EDI, or Groovy; Utilizing Jenkins, Putty, Tortoise SVN, SOAP UI, FileZilla, or Splunk.
